Jailed business baron Conrad Black has endorsed a Toronto mayoral candidate in his lengthy column, while slamming two others. Black jumped into the race yesterday in a jailhouse column from his cell at the low-security prison in Coleman, Florida. The British Lord supports Sarah Thomson in his column, saying she’s youngish, attractive, intelligent and a competent business woman. He dogged George Smitherman and Rocco Rossi saying they are not the people for the job. Black is in his third year of a six and a half year sentence for fraud and obstruction of justice.
